People & Culture and Learning Coordinator

Indonesia Sofitel Bali Nusa Dua Beach Resort Data Not Available*
Job Description

The People & Culture and Learning Coordinator at Sofitel Bali Nusa Dua Beach Resort is responsible for supporting the HR team in implementing people strategies and learning initiatives. Candidates should have a degree in Human Resources or a related field, with experience in HR and training roles. Strong communication, organizational, and interpersonal skills are essential. The role involves coordinating training programs, assisting with employee engagement activities, and supporting the recruitment process.

Company Info

Sofitel Bali Nusa Dua Beach Resort is a luxury beachfront resort located in the prestigious Nusa Dua area of Bali, Indonesia. Known for its elegant French-inspired design and Balinese hospitality, the resort offers a range of upscale accommodations, dining options, and leisure facilities. It is part of the AccorHotels group, a global leader in hospitality, known for its commitment to providing exceptional guest experiences and fostering a diverse and inclusive workplace.

Destination Guide

Indonesia, with its rich cultural heritage and diverse landscapes, offers a unique lifestyle for expatriates. Bali, in particular, is a popular destination for its vibrant culture, beautiful beaches, and welcoming community. Job opportunities in Bali often focus on tourism, hospitality, and creative industries. The cost of living varies, with affordable options available outside tourist hotspots. The culture is a blend of traditional Balinese customs and modern influences. For relocation, a visa is required, typically a work or business visa for employment. It's advisable to secure a job before moving, as this can facilitate the visa process. The island offers a laid-back lifestyle, with plenty of opportunities for outdoor activities and cultural exploration.
